Abstract

A method of optimizing operation of a telecommunications network when traffic demand exceeds capacity of the network. The method comprises retrieving a call data record of a first subscriber; analyzing phone calls and/or text messages made and received by said first subscriber; creating a representation of a social network of said first subscriber based on the call data record; and suspending part of the subscribers from said social network in a way that at least one member of said social network is not suspended.

Claims

exact text as granted — not AI-modified
1 . A method of optimising operation of a telecommunications network in a situation of traffic demand exceeding capacity of the network, the method comprising:
 retrieving a call data record of a first subscriber of the telecommunications network;   analysing phone calls and/or text messages made and received by said first subscriber;   creating a representation of a social network of said first subscriber based on the call data record; and   suspending provision of telecommunications services to part of the subscribers from said social network, wherein the subscribers to be suspended are selected in a way that at least one member of said social network derived from the call data record is not suspended.   
     
     
         2 . The method according to  claim 1  further comprising:
 sending a message by the telecommunications network to the not-suspended subscriber requesting said not-suspended subscriber to rely messages to members of his social network; and 
 sending a message by the telecommunications network to the subscribers to be suspended identifying the not-suspended member of the social network. 
 
     
     
         3 . The method according to  claim 1 , wherein the steps of the method are carried out in relation to all subscribers served by the telecommunications network located in an area affected by the traffic demand exceeding capacity of the telecommunications network. 
     
     
         4 . The method according to  claim 1 , wherein a subscriber is not suspended if a distance from said subscriber to a nearest not-suspended member of his social network is greater than a defined distance. 
     
     
         5 . The method according to  claim 1 , wherein a subscriber is not suspended if a number of phone calls or text messages between said subscriber and the nearest not-suspended member of his social network is lower than a defined value. 
     
     
         6 . The method according to  claim 1 , further comprising:
 identifying in the call data record phone numbers of non-human subscribers and/or phone numbers of premium lines; and   creating a modified record based on said call data record, wherein in said modified record said phone numbers of non-human subscribers and/or phone numbers of premium lines are removed.   
     
     
         7 . A method of operating a telecommunications network comprising transmitting messages to selected subscribers, the method comprising:
 retrieving a call data record of a first subscriber of the telecommunications network;   identifying in the call data record phone numbers of non-human subscribers and/or phone numbers of premium phone lines;   creating a modified record based on said call data record, wherein in said modified record said phone numbers of non-human subscribers and/or phone numbers of premium phone lines are removed; and   transmitting a message to subscribers remaining on said modified record.   
     
     
         8 . The method according to  claim 7 , wherein the message is sent to the subscribers remaining on said modified record following a request from the first subscriber to regenerate a phone book of a user equipment of said first subscriber. 
     
     
         9 . The method according to  claim 8 , wherein the message sent to the subscribers remaining on said modified record comprises a request to send a reply specifying the name of the sending subscriber. 
     
     
         10 . The method according to  claim 9  comprising a step of regenerating the phone book based on received replies. 
     
     
         11 . The method according to  claim 7 , wherein the transmitted message is a message received from the first subscriber.
